Head of School job summary

Following the successful promotion and the retirement of two of our existing Senior Leadership Team, the Federation Governors wish to appoint a new Head of School for Shadwell Primary School and a new Head of School for Bramham Primary School.

The successful applicants should have relevant experience and exceptional practice to work together with the Executive Head Teacher and the wider Senior Leadership Team in leading their school with the Federation vision, values and ethos in achieving a world-class education for our children. They will be driven and determined to ensure high standards of behaviour and achievement and balance this with an understanding for nurturing children and in promoting their well-being in achieving 'Excellence for All'.

The Head of School will be a highly influential position and will be regarded by staff, parents and the wider community as Senior Lead for the school.

We expect the very best from our children and in return, we give them the very best education. In this way, you will need to:

• Have a proven record of leading, managing, developing, inspiring and motivating staff and able to work collaboratively and efficiently as part of a team
• Demonstrate the skills needed to develop and maintain an outstanding learning environment including good organisational skills, passion and creativity
• Have excellent interpersonal skills
• Be an outstanding practitioner with a deep understanding of the National Curriculum
• Have experience in inclusive practice and oversee excellent progress is made by every child

Commitment to safeguarding

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.

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.

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children

You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
